From the setting of focus deficit hyperactivity problem (ADHD), clonidine's molecular mechanism of action happens due to its agonism at the α2A adrenergic receptor, the subtype of your adrenergic receptor that is certainly most principally present in the Mind.
Clonidine is in a category of medications named centrally acting alpha-agonist hypotensive brokers. Clonidine treats high hypertension by lowering your heart fee and stress-free the blood vessels to make sure that blood can circulation extra conveniently through the physique. Clonidine extended-launch tablets may possibly handle ADHD by affecting the A part of the Mind that controls awareness and impulsivity.

Clonidine might also bring about bradycardia, theoretically by expanding signaling with the vagus nerve. When presented intravenously, clonidine can temporarily maximize blood pressure by stimulating α1 receptors in clean muscles in blood vessels.
